The World Show begins this Sunday with a live electronic mix by Nini Maluks, a talented producer.
A living legend of South African music, Moses Ngwenya, is a talented pianist and keyboardist who was a founding member of the Mbaqanga group "The Soul Brothers" in 1974. He will then join us. We'll be listening to some of his funky sounds from the Black Moses catalogue. He's also known by the loving moniker Black Moses.
